MONOTONICITY OF THE FIRST EIGENVALUE OF THE LAPLACE AND THE p-LAPLACE OPERATORS UNDER A FORCED MEAN CURVATURE FLOW

  • The asymmetric Laplace distribution arises as a limiting distribution of geometric summations of independent and identically distributed random variables with finite second moments. The main purpose of this paper is to study the weak limit theorems for geometric summations of independent (not necessarily identically distributed) random variables together with convergence rates to asymmetric Laplace distributions. Using Trotter-operator method, the orders of approximations of the distributions of geometric summations by the asymmetric Laplace distributions are established in term of the "large-𝒪" and "small-o" approximation estimates. The obtained results are extensions of some known ones.

  • The Quaternionic Dirac operator proves instrumental in tackling various challenges within spectral geometry processing and shape analysis. This work involves the introduction of the quaternionic Dirac operator on a symplectic submanifold of an exact symplectic product manifold. The self adjointness of the symplectic quaternionic Dirac operator is observed. This operator is verified for spin ${\frac{1}{2}}$ particles. It factorizes the Hodge Laplace operator on the symplectic submanifold of an exact symplectic product manifold. For achieving this a new complex structure and an almost quaternionic structure are formulated on this exact symplectic product manifold.
